Understanding انواع تأمين السيارات في السعودية

Car insurance in Saudi Arabia primarily falls into three categories:

  1. Third-Party Liability Insurance – A mandatory insurance policy that covers damage caused to other vehicles, property, or individuals in case of an accident.
  2. Comprehensive Insurance – A broader coverage plan that includes third-party liabilities and damages to the insured vehicle, regardless of fault.
  3. Collision and Theft Insurance – A middle ground between the two, covering accidents and theft but not all types of damage.

Insurance Considerations for Petrol Cars

Petrol cars dominate the roads in Saudi Arabia due to their availability, fuelling infrastructure, and familiarity among drivers. Since they have been used for decades, insurance companies have well-established risk assessment models for petrol vehicles.

Insurance for petrol cars is relatively stable as insurers have developed comprehensive risk models over time. Factors such as engine capacity and performance are crucial in determining insurance costs. Higher engine capacities generally increase premiums due to increased speed and accident risks. Additionally, petrol cars pose a higher fire hazard due to fuel combustion, which is reflected in insurance policy considerations. Maintenance and repair costs also influence insurance pricing, with petrol cars benefiting from a widespread repair network that ensures the availability of spare parts, potentially lowering premiums. Theft risk is another crucial factor, as some petrol models are more likely to be stolen, affecting comprehensive insurance pricing.

Insurance Considerations for Electric Cars

Electric cars are relatively new to the Saudi market, and their insurance landscape is evolving. Due to differences in technology and risk factors, insurance companies take a different approach when calculating premiums for EVs.

Electric vehicle insurance costs are higher due to the expensive battery replacement and specialized repair services. Since the battery is the most valuable component of an EV, insurers factor in potential replacement costs when determining premiums. Additionally, the advanced technology in EVs requires specialized technicians and repair facilities, leading to higher repair costs than traditional petrol vehicles. However, EVs generally have a lower fire risk due to the absence of combustible fuel, though lithium-ion batteries still carry a risk of overheating.

Another advantage of electric vehicles is that they have fewer moving parts compared to petrol cars, reducing wear and tear and minimizing the frequency of damage claims. Some insurance providers also offer incentives for EV owners as part of green energy initiatives, potentially lowering premiums. However, given that EV insurance policies are still developing, the availability of tailored coverage remains limited compared to petrol car policies.
